Drilling Fluid Loss Additive is a special chemical used in oil and gas drilling, designed to prevent drilling fluid from losing too much fluid in the formation, and reduce drilling fluid leakage and loss problems . The main function of the drilling anti-slump agent is to enhance the sealing and stability of the drilling fluid during the drilling process to ensure the integrity and safety of the wellbore.
